>
> Given the clock-names, shouldn't the clock indices be the other way around? Also see below.

You're right, they should have been the other way around! Didn't make
any difference at testing because the usi driver uses
clk_bulk_prepare_enable(), what matters is the order of clocks in the
i2c node, and those are fine.
